In 2022, Florida recorded 1,474,730 FBI NICS firearm background checks, equivalent to 87.4 per 1K residents. Handgun checks accounted for 51% of all checks, while long gun checks made up 20%. Background checks decreased 13.8% compared to 2021.

NICS checks are conducted for firearm purchases, permits, and other transactions. A single check does not necessarily equal one firearm sale.

Background Checks by Year

YearTotal ChecksChange
20181,203,145β€”
20191,195,539-0.6%
20201,912,204+59.9%
20211,711,685-10.5%
20221,474,730-13.8%

Overview

Black residents make up 17.1% of Florida's population but 47.6% of the prison population (2.8x overrepresented). White residents are 56.8% of the population but 39.0% of prisoners. These disparities reflect well-documented patterns in the U.S. criminal justice system.

Florida had a total prison population of 87,207 in 2023, an imprisonment rate of 517 per 100,000 residents. There were 27,097 new admissions and 25,288 releases. 13.3% of prisoners were held in private facilities.

In 2024, Florida's 62 reporting counties had a combined jail population of 49,200 with an average county jail rate of 569 per 100,000 residents. A total of 511,809 jail admissions were recorded across the state.

Between 2018 and 2024, Florida's 67 counties reported a combined 21,228 firearm-related deaths, a rate of 13.7 per 100,000 residents. Of those, 7,386 (35%) were homicides and 13,632 (64%) were suicides. There were 34 accidental firearm deaths. County-level death counts of 9 or fewer are suppressed by the CDC for privacy; actual statewide totals may be higher.
